The Concept of Smart City Car Keys
Smart Roadster Car Keys city car keys are essentially digital keys allowing seamless gain access to and control over vehicles by means of smart devices, key fobs, or other electronic devices. They take advantage of Internet of Things (IoT) innovations, making it possible to open doors, start engines, and even track your automobile's location from a distance. This development becomes part of the larger smart city efforts focused on producing interconnected systems that make city living more effective and eco-friendly.

Smart city car keys run using a mix of software and hardware technologies. Here's a breakdown of the elements included:
1. Mobile phone Application
A devoted app permits users to control their car keys practically, giving access to numerous functions such as locking/unlocking doors and locating the automobile.
2. Bluetooth or NFC Technology
Smart keys often utilize Bluetooth or Near Field Communication (NFC) to communicate with the car, permitting for close-range interaction.
3. Cloud-based Services
These services provide a platform for user information storage and management. They can from another location disable a lost key, update software, and boost security procedures.
4. Lorry Sensors
Geared up with sensing units, vehicles can acknowledge the presence of a smart key, activate upon its technique, and lock when the user strolls away, adding layers of convenience.

As appealing as smart city car keys may be, they feature their own set of challenges.
1. Security Concerns
While Auto Smart Key Replacement keys offer enhanced security, they are not invulnerable. Hackers may exploit vulnerabilities in the software application or innovation used.
2. Dependence on Technology
The dependence on technology can present issues if the system stops working or if the smartphone battery passes away, leaving the user stranded.
3. Privacy Issues
The usage of tracking functions raises issues about privacy. Users need to be knowledgeable about how their data is being utilized and kept.

Q2: What if I lose my mobile phone that works as my car key?
A2: Most systems permit users to disable or delete the digital key from another gadget or web website to prevent unauthorized gain access to.
Q3: Can smart city car keys work separately of the web?
A3: While some fundamental functions might work offline through Bluetooth, many functions count on web connectivity for ideal functionality.
Q4: Are these keys costly to change?
A4: Replacing a New Smart Car Key key may be more pricey than traditional keys due to innovation and reprogramming expenses involved.
Q5: What occurs if the battery in my smart key fob runs out?
A5: Users can often still access the vehicle by utilizing a backup entry method supplied throughout purchase, like a physical key hidden within the fob.
